In this world, Rex Salazar’s story began much like it did in the main universe. He was a boy infected with nanites, capable of creating powerful machines and constructs from his body, and uniquely able to cure others infected by the EVO mutation. But beyond that, everything diverged.
Unlike the original timeline, there was no Agent Six to protect him. No Doctor Holiday to treat him like a human being. No brotherly bond with Bobo Haha. No team, no warmth. In this version of events, Rex 23 was found by Providence and immediately classified not as a boy, but as a weapon. A subject. An asset.
He was stripped of identity, locked away in a cold cell rather than given a room. His days were filled with detached training, cruel experiments, and 24/7 surveillance. Over time, the abuse and isolation wore him down. Not only did Rex 23 forget who he was—he forgot how to be. He forgot how to smile. How to speak. Even how to hope.
Yet, despite everything, a flicker of humanity remained.
He found a strange sort of comfort in the rare clips of a flamboyant young hero broadcast through Providence’s filtered media. The one and only Ben 23—the celebrity counterpart of Ben Tennyson from a more glamorous alternate reality. Cocky, stylish, always in the spotlight. Ben 23 was everything Rex wasn’t: free, adored, unapologetically himself. And something about him… about his confidence, his fire, his defiance—mesmerized Rex.
So when whispers echoed through the metal corridors of Providence one day—rumors that Ben 23 himself was visiting headquarters—Rex 23’s lifeless eyes lit up for the first time in years.
By pure accident—or perhaps fate—Ben 23 got bored during his tour and slipped away from his handlers. While exploring Providence’s deeper levels, he stumbled upon something he wasn’t supposed to see: a boy, barely older than himself, starved, silent, and hollow-eyed in a pitch-black cell. A boy who looked at him with something terrifyingly close to worship.
The Providence agents tried to pull him away. But Ben 23 didn’t do rules. And whatever Ben 23 wanted? Ben 23 got.
So he broke Rex out of his cage, and sprinted away from the only life Rex had ever known.
Their story together is just beginning.
